What is Testing for Material Degradation Under Water Immersion?

Testing for Material Degradation Under Water Immersion involves exposing samples of various materials to water at different temperatures and pressures for extended periods. This process allows our expert technicians to assess the materials resistance to corrosion, creep, and fatigue caused by prolonged exposure to water.

Our state-of-the-art laboratory is equipped with specialized equipment designed to mimic real-world conditions, ensuring that our testing protocols are both rigorous and accurate. We employ a range of testing techniques, including

  • Water immersion at various temperatures (up to 95C)

  • High-pressure testing (up to 1000 bar)

  • Corrosion monitoring using electrochemical impedance spectroscopy (EIS)
